Gene function (GO predictions)

GO predictions are based solely on the InterPro-to-GO mappings published by EMBL-EBI, which are in turn based on the mapping of predicted domains to the InterPro dataset. The InterPro-to-GO mapping was last updated on , while the GO metadata was last updated on .

GO term Namespace Name Definition Relationships
Biological process Cation transport The directed movement of cations, atoms or small molecules with a net positive charge, into, out of or within a cell, or between cells, by means of some agent such as a transporter or pore.
Molecular function Cation transmembrane transporter activity Enables the transfer of cation from one side of a membrane to the other.
Biological process Transmembrane transport The process in which a solute is transported across a lipid bilayer, from one side of a membrane to the other.
